Print installation.
view larger image
Title
Print installation.
Venues
National Art Gallery [Thailand]. (3 July 1991 – 21 July 1991)
Date
(1991)
Summary
Multi-artist exhibition. Located: Thailand
Country of context
Thailand
Last Updated
04 Jul 2012